It was a bloody affair in the exciting game between Sligo Rovers and St. Patrick’s Athletic tonight in Inchicore
By Adrian Collins
Alan Keane will remember tonight’s game for all the wrong reasons after his side’s undefeated run came to an end at the hands of St. Pat’s.
However, he also will be heading home with a broken nose for his troubles, after a clash of heads in which he went down clutching his face, which was streaming blood.
